Transaction d177eaefcb02c97480fa57df136b9c75b57d0fc2b70f8e64ee89f7b710798d28

1 Input
2 Outputs
  • d177eaefcb02c97480fa57df136b9c75b57d0fc2b70f8e64ee89f7b710798d28:0
  • value  90320
    address  3MFe2NvtcPwfM81wQHpgAkPoEdZhSCJ6wV
  • d177eaefcb02c97480fa57df136b9c75b57d0fc2b70f8e64ee89f7b710798d28:1
  • value  67039184
    address  1GKFfuiC4hXrWfJC7tmiK9Xt4XzjVUieKJ